How to Withdraw Bitcoin (BTC) Using OKX's Lightning Network

·

The Lightning Network is a layer-2 payment protocol designed to facilitate fast, low-cost Bitcoin transactions. By processing transactions off-chain before settling them on the Bitcoin blockchain, it overcomes scalability limitations while maintaining decentralization. Step-by-Step Guide to Lightning Network Withdrawals

Via Web Browser

  1. Log In to your OKX account and navigate to AssetsWithdraw.
  2. Select BTC as the cryptocurrency and choose On-Chain withdrawal method.
  3. Switch the network to BTC-Lightning – the "Address" field will auto-update to "Lightning Invoice."
  4. Paste the Lightning Invoice from your receiving platform, review the amount and fees, then confirm.

  5. Complete 2FA verification and submit.

Via Mobile App

  1. Open the OKX app, go to AssetsWithdraw.
  2. Select BTC and On-Chain withdrawal.
  3. Choose BTC-Lightning as the network.
  4. Enter the Lightning Invoice, verify details, and tap Submit.

Note: Ensure your withdrawal amount meets OKX’s minimum threshold and stays within your account limits.


FAQs

Q1: What’s the minimum withdrawal amount?

A: Varies by account tier. Check OKX’s current requirements in the withdrawal interface.

Q2: Why is my Lightning withdrawal failing?

A: Common issues include incorrect invoices, insufficient funds, or exceeding daily limits. Double-check invoice validity and account balance.

Q3: How do I get a Lightning invoice?

A: Generate one from a Lightning-compatible wallet (e.g., Muun, Phoenix) or exchange that supports LN deposits.

Q4: Are Lightning withdrawals reversible?

A: No. Transactions are instant and irreversible once broadcasted. Always verify invoice details.
